What does a biomedical engineer new graduate do?

A Biomedical Engineer New Graduate applies engineering principles to solve problems in biology and medicine, often working on the design, development, and testing of medical devices or healthcare technologies. In entry-level roles, they may assist with research, perform data analysis, support product development, or help maintain medical equipment. New graduates often work as part of interdisciplinary teams, collaborating with scientists, healthcare professionals, and other engineers to improve patient care and medical outcomes. Their work can span hospitals, research labs, or medical device companies, providing a diverse range of opportunities to start their careers.

What are the key skills and qualifications needed to thrive as a biomedical engineer new graduate?

To thrive as a Biomedical Engineer New Graduate, you need a solid grounding in engineering principles, biology, and mathematics, typically supported by a bachelor's degree in biomedical engineering or a related field. Familiarity with CAD software, data analysis tools like MATLAB, and knowledge of regulatory standards such as FDA or ISO is highly beneficial. Strong problem-solving abilities, teamwork, and effective communication skills help you collaborate across multidisciplinary teams and convey technical information clearly. These skills and qualifications are critical for developing safe, innovative medical devices and ensuring compliance within the highly regulated healthcare industry.

What types of projects and responsibilities can a biomedical engineer new graduate expect during their first year on the job?

As a new graduate biomedical engineer, you can expect to work on a variety of entry-level projects such as assisting with product design, testing medical devices, or supporting research and development teams. You'll likely collaborate closely with experienced engineers, clinicians, and regulatory specialists to ensure products meet safety and quality standards. Typical responsibilities may include data analysis, technical documentation, and troubleshooting equipment. This role often provides structured mentorship and training to help you build foundational skills and understand industry regulations, setting the stage for future career growth.

What is the difference between Biomedical Engineer New Graduate vs Biomedical Technician?

AspectBiomedical Engineer New GraduateBiomedical Technician
Required CredentialsBachelor's in Biomedical Engineering or related field; entry-levelBachelor's in Biomedical Engineering, Biomedical Technology, or related field; entry-level
Work EnvironmentDesign, development, and testing of medical devices; labs and officesMaintenance, repair, and calibration of medical equipment; hospitals and clinics
Employer & Industry UsageMedical device companies, healthcare facilities, research institutionsHospitals, clinics, medical equipment suppliers

Biomedical Engineer New Graduates focus on designing and developing medical devices, often working in labs and research settings. In contrast, Biomedical Technicians primarily maintain and repair medical equipment in clinical environments. Both roles require similar educational backgrounds but differ in daily tasks and work settings.
